These striking water urns date from the 18th Century and were originally used for storing drinking water. A wooden lid was most likely used to seal them closed. They were handmade with the colombin clay technique. The blue patina has been applied in the last 10 years or so. These would look stunning displayed indoors or in the garden illuminated at night.
Condition and patina consistent with age.
Average 20 ½'' diameter x 34 ¾'' high
Average 52cm diameter x 88cm high
